Als ich nach der Konfiguration von sendmail auf Ubuntu gesucht habe, bekomme ich keine klare Antwort. Jeder von ihnen geht davon aus, dass ich weiß, wovon er spricht.
Ich möchte nur die Grundkonfiguration, um das Senden von E-Mails zu aktivieren. Im Grunde werde ich sie mit der Google App Engine verwenden, um das Senden von E-Mails vom Entwickler-Server zu aktivieren.
Ich habe das schon gemacht:
sudo apt-get install sendmail
dann
sudo sendmailconfig
aber ich weiß nicht, was der letzte tatsächlich getan hat.
sendmail
es veraltet ist (es gibt viel bessere Alternativen!), War mein Kommentar vor FÜNF JAHREN einfach die Tatsache, dass wir keine so alten Fragen auf eine andere SE-Site migrieren.Antworten:
Wenn Sie eingegeben haben
sudo sendmailconfig
, sollten Sie aufgefordert worden sein, sendmail zu konfigurieren.Als Referenz befinden sich die Dateien, die während der Konfiguration aktualisiert werden, wie folgt (falls Sie sie manuell aktualisieren möchten):
Sie können sendmail testen, um festzustellen, ob es ordnungsgemäß konfiguriert und eingerichtet ist, indem Sie Folgendes in die Befehlszeile eingeben:
Mit den folgenden Optionen können Sie sendmail ein SMTP-Relay hinzufügen:
Fügen Sie sendmail.mc die folgenden Zeilen hinzu, jedoch vorher dem
MAILERDEFINITIONS
. Stellen Sie sicher, dass Sie Ihren SMTP-Server aktualisieren.Rufen Sie die Erstellung sendmail.cf auf (alternativ ausführen
make -C /etc/mail
):Starten Sie den sendmail-Daemon neu:
quelle
your.isp.net
, setze ichgmail.com
odersmtp.gmail.com
dort?sendmail.mc
Datei die Form BACKTICK + Ihr Text + EINZELZITAT haben.Ich habe die beste Antwort nach einer kleinen Bearbeitung erhalten (kann noch nicht antworten)
Das hat bei mir nicht funktioniert:
Das erste einfache Anführungszeichen für jede Zeichenfolge sollte in einen Backtick (`) wie folgt geändert werden:
Nach der Änderung renne ich:
Und ich bin im Geschäft :)
quelle
Kombiniere zwei Antworten oben, ich lasse es endlich funktionieren. Achten Sie nur darauf, dass das erste einfache Anführungszeichen für jede Zeichenfolge ein Backtick (`) in der Datei sendmail.mc ist.
quelle
AuthInfo:smtp.gmail.com "U:username" "P:password"
AuthInfo: smtp.gmail.com "U:[email protected]" "P:yourpassword"